Intégration d'un client SIP javascript dans un widget - Problème de stabilité de la connexion

Bonjour à tous,

Je suis entrain d’intégrer un client SIP dans le widget de mon plugin. Ca commence a fonctionner pas trop mal mais j’ai un soucis. Le client javascript ouvre un websocket WSS sur le port 8089 vers un serveur SIP.

Quand je teste mon code a l’extérieur de Jeedom tout marche bien le websocket est bien stable mais dans jeedom quand j’intègre mon code javascript dans mon widget j’ai des déconnexions très fréquentes (toutes les 2 minutes environs).

Avez-vous une idée d’ou cela peut venir?

Merci

J’ai fais quelques essais avec un autre port et le problème reste le même.

J’ai pu obtenir le code d’erreur invoqué par le websocket lors de la déconnexion et il s’agit du code 1006. En recherchant par internet il semble que les navigateurs modernes ferme les websocket après une période d’inactivité.

J’ai modifié mon code pour faire transiter des dummy data sur le websocket et il semble que cela fonctionne.

Donc merci pour votre aide mais ca ne venait pas de Jeedom.

Ce sujet a été automatiquement fermé après 24 heures suivant le dernier commentaire. Aucune réponse n’est permise dorénavant.